Then thing about criticism is that, even though we all live in the same town and play music, we pretty much have totally different tastes. So good luck! I'm hesitant to answer these type of thing, but you seem forthright and friendly, so:

Music: It's not my style, so I don't feel qualified to give criticism on that front. It seems put together though: layered, thought out and pulled off in both ability and recording. It seems like the most pro part, but I can't tell you if people will like it.

Image: There aren't really group shots on the site? Not big ones or quality ones anyway (they pop up at the same size as the thumbnails).
Hard to judge the look or aesthetic- it is casual and not unified; kinda takes away from an "image," and doesn't match the slickness of the design-oriented site look.
Too much personal stuff also takes away from an image- it's scattershot. I'd have a single blurb/brief bio for each, and if you want more detail make the members get individual myspace pages and just link to them. You may well be a team of individuals and think that a strength, but the audience needs to be able to file you mentally.
I'm pretty big into image, and would like to see more polish.

Website: Good general design framwork, just needs more content.
I think there are too many fonts- The coldness of the label-maker font on the metal logo-thing clashes with the earthiness of the serif-font on the tabs. I'm not a fan of that serif font anyway, especially if you use the more straight (arial?) font for the home content, and then another straight font for the who-is page. I'd match them up more- I think that serif fantasy-style font only works if the rest of the design is done around it.
As I mentioned above: the photos are small, varied, not of high quality and the pop-ups are the same size. You haven't done a photo shoot so they are just placeholders, and thats fine, but there isn't much constructive to say for that reason.
Why both Doppler and Groundlift again? That's confusing.

In general: You are clearly motivated and can play, but portions seem inconsistent or probably just unfinished. I think you already know this, but are just feeling impatient?
